Marquette Pulls Out a 53-51 Win Over Belmont
12/21/2019 5:17:00 PM | Women's Basketball
King and Spingola lead with 12 points each
MILWAUKEE—A 7-0 run to close out the fourth quarter helped the Marquette women's basketball team to a 53-51 win over Belmont on Saturday afternoon to close out non-conference action leading into a holiday break.
Marquette has won five straight games and heads into BIG EAST play with a 9-2 overall record.
The Golden Eagles trailed by as many as 12 points in the second quarter and only led for nine minutes of the game, but late defense down the stretch to gain key stops over Belmont (5-6) helped secure the win. Senior Isabelle Spingola and freshman Jordan King led Marquette with 12 points apiece, while freshman Camryn Taylor added nine points.
Senior Altia Anderson and redshirt junior Lauren Van Kleunen grabbed eight and seven rebounds, respectively as junior Selena Lott dished out a career-high-tying nine assists.
The Golden Eagles scored 30 of their 53 points in the paint and forced Belmont to commit 19 turnovers.
Maura Muensterman and Ellie Harmeyer led the Bruins with 16 and 11 points, respectively.
UP NEXT: Marquette will open BIG EAST play with three road games beginning Sunday, Dec. 29 at DePaul. Tip-off is set for 4 p.m. CT.
